Function
Catalyzes the transfer of sulfate to position 6 of galactose (Gal) residues of keratan. Has a preference for sulfating keratan sulfate, but it also transfers sulfate to the unsulfated polymer. The sulfotransferase activity on sialyl LacNAc structures is much higher than the corresponding desialylated substrate, and only internal Gal residues are sulfated. May function in the sulfation of sialyl N-acetyllactosamine oligosaccharide chains attached to glycoproteins. Participates in biosynthesis of selectin ligands. Selectin ligands are present in high endothelial cells (HEVs) and play a central role in lymphocyte homing at sites of inflammation. -
Tissue specificity
Widely expressed at low level. Expressed in brain and skeletal muscle. Expressed by high endothelial cells (HEVs) and leukocytes. -
Sequence similarities
Belongs to the sulfotransferase 1 family. Gal/GlcNAc/GalNAc subfamily. -
Cellular localization
Golgi apparatus membrane. - Information by UniProt
